Sympol™ Transceiver
This manual describes the SN65HVD96 Evaluation Module (EVM). This EVM helps designers evaluate
the device performance under wire-fault and common-mode conditions, thus supporting the fast
development and analysis of data transmission systems using SN65HVD96 transceivers.
